The Career:
Are you passionate about innovation, quality, and making a difference? If so, great news - QA1 is looking for a talented Manufacturing Designer to join our Lakeville, MN location. This role offers the opportunity to work on cutting-edge products that not only meet but exceed industry expectations. As a member of the QA1 team, you’ll be responsible for creating precise technical drawings, managing and updating bills of material within ERP and PDM systems, and ensuring efficient workflow through the engineering change notice process.
You’ll support the Engineering Manager, and your success in this role will depend on your ability to produce detailed technical drawings and documentation.
- Design and develop CAD models and assemblies using Solid Works
- Produce detailed technical drawings and documentation
- Create assembly drawings with exploded views to support installation and work instructions
- Update engineering documents through the Engineering Change Notice (ECN) process
- Collaborate closely with design and manufacturing engineers to assist in new product development
- Maintain accurate product data in Infor Syteline ERP, including descriptions, revisions, drawing numbers, and Bills of Material (BOM)
- Generate new part numbers and BOMs for engineering changes and new product introductions

QA1 is a privately held leader in performance shocks, steering and suspension systems, chassis, rod ends and related components for the motorsports and industrial markets. With multiple U.S.
-based manufacturing facilities equipped with state-of-the-art technology, we are committed to delivering high-quality products that meet the demanding standards of our customers.
